华为模拟器ensp是一款用于网络实验的命令行工具,它模拟网络设备的工作环境,通过命令行界面实现网络设备的配置、管理和测试。该工具常用于学习网络协议、实践网络配置技能,是网络工程师培训的重要辅助平台。
基本命令操作指南:ensp的核心操作围绕启动、设备进入和模式切换展开。启动模拟器时,输入“ensp start”命令,系统将加载模拟环境并进入命令提示符。退出模拟器时,输入“exit”命令即可关闭所有设备并退出。进入设备后,需通过“enable”命令进入特权模式,该模式允许执行所有配置命令;“configure”命令则进入全局配置模式,用于配置全局参数和接口属性。模式切换通过“exit”命令返回上一级模式,如从全局配置模式退出到特权模式。
接口配置命令详解:接口配置是网络设备配置的基础,interface命令用于指定要配置的物理接口。例如,“interface GigabitEthernet0/0”命令选择GigabitEthernet0/0接口进行配置。配置接口IP地址时,使用“ip address”命令,格式为“ip address IP地址 子网掩码”,如“ip address 192.168.1.1 255.255.255.0”为接口分配IP地址和子网掩码。配置完成后,需通过“no shutdown”命令启用接口,否则接口处于关闭状态,无法进行数据传输。
路由配置命令说明:路由配置用于实现不同网络之间的通信,ip route命令用于配置静态路由。该命令的格式为“ip route 目的地址 子网掩码 下一跳地址”,其中“目的地址”是需要到达的网络地址,“子网掩码”用于确定网络范围,“下一跳地址”是数据包转发到的下一跳设备的IP地址。例如,“ip route 10.0.0.0 255.0.0.0 192.168.1.2”表示当数据包需要发送到10.0.0.0/8网络时,通过下一跳地址192.168.1.2转发。配置静态路由后,需确保下一跳地址可达,否则路由无法生效。
网络测试命令使用:网络测试命令用于验证网络配置的正确性和连通性,ping命令是最常用的测试工具,用于检测设备间是否可达。例如,“ping 192.168.1.2”命令向目标设备发送ICMP回显请求,目标设备返回回显应答,输出结果中“Reply from 192.168.1.2: bytes=32 time=1ms TTL=64”表示连通性良好。如果输出“Request timed out”,则表示目标设备不可达。tracert命令用于追踪数据包从源到目标的路径,显示经过的路由器IP地址和延迟时间,例如“tracert 192.168.1.2”会列出中间路由器的信息,帮助定位网络故障。
常见问题与解决:在使用ensp命令时,常见问题包括命令执行失败和配置错误。例如,当输入“ip address”命令后没有指定子网掩码时,系统会提示“Missing parameter: mask”,此时需补充子网掩码参数。另外,权限不足时无法执行某些命令,需先进入特权模式。对于接口未启用的问题,可通过“no shutdown”命令启用接口。通过仔细检查命令参数和模式切换,可解决大部分常见问题。